Are There Redwoods in Washington State?

Redwood trees often spark curiosity about their natural range. Many wonder if these towering giants extend their habitat into Washington State. Understanding their distribution requires exploring the specific species commonly referred to as redwoods and their unique environments.

Redwoods in Washington

True redwood species, such as the Coast Redwood (Sequoia sempervirens) and the Giant Sequoia (Sequoiadendron giganteum), are not native to Washington State. Their natural populations thrive in specific climatic conditions found further south along the Pacific Coast or in California’s Sierra Nevada mountains.

While not naturally occurring, specimens of these impressive trees can be found planted in various locations throughout Washington. These cultivated trees often grow in arboretums, public parks, and on private properties, where they have been introduced for ornamental or conservation purposes. For example, the Washington Park Arboretum in Seattle features stands of Coast Redwoods and Giant Sequoias, showcasing their ability to survive when planted and cared for. However, Washington’s cooler temperatures and different precipitation patterns do not support the widespread natural regeneration and proliferation that define a native population.

Types of Redwood Trees

The term “redwood” commonly refers to three distinct coniferous species, each with unique characteristics and native ranges.

The Coast Redwood (Sequoia sempervirens) is the world’s tallest tree species, primarily found along the foggy coastal regions of California and a small part of southwestern Oregon. These trees depend on consistent coastal fog for moisture during dry summer months, allowing them to reach heights exceeding 380 feet and live for over 2,000 years. Its bark is thick, fibrous, and reddish-brown, providing fire resistance.

Another species is the Giant Sequoia (Sequoiadendron giganteum), recognized as the most massive tree on Earth by volume. This species is native to the western slopes of the Sierra Nevada mountains in California, typically growing at elevations between 4,500 and 7,000 feet. Giant Sequoias can reach heights of over 300 feet and boast trunk diameters exceeding 25 feet, with some individuals living for more than 3,000 years. Their cones are larger and their needles are more scale-like than those of the Coast Redwood.

The third species, the Dawn Redwood (Metasequoia glyptostroboides), is a deciduous conifer, shedding its needles annually. This tree was once thought to be extinct and is native to a small region of China. While it shares some visual similarities with its evergreen relatives, the Dawn Redwood is generally smaller, typically reaching heights of around 160 feet. It is frequently planted as an ornamental tree in many temperate climates due to its rapid growth and attractive fall foliage.

Washington’s Native Giants

Washington State hosts its own native tree species that reach impressive sizes. The Douglas Fir (Pseudotsuga menziesii) is widespread and recognizable, known for its immense height.

These conifers can grow over 300 feet tall and live for more than 500 years, thriving across various elevations from sea level to subalpine zones. Their straight, columnar trunks and distinctive cones make them a prominent feature of the Pacific Northwest landscape.

The Western Redcedar (Thuja plicata) is another native giant, celebrated for its large girth and cultural significance to indigenous peoples. These trees are characterized by their shaggy, reddish-brown bark, broad, buttressed bases, and aromatic wood. Western Redcedars can reach heights of 150 to 200 feet, with trunk diameters of 10 to 20 feet, and some individuals have lived for over 1,000 years in moist, temperate rainforest environments.

The Sitka Spruce (Picea sitchensis) is one of the largest spruce species globally, found predominantly in Washington’s coastal fog belt. It thrives in wet, cool conditions, often growing directly along the coastline and in river valleys. Its stiff, sharp needles and unique root system allow it to withstand strong coastal winds.
